Sunday Sketch | Anna-Maria

This week, our layout sketch is an 8.5x11 layout with a grid design and plenty of white space. Our card sketch features a trio of circle elements and our Project Life sketch uses a 3x4 photo, caption on an angle and room for journaling. Hi everybody! I have an honour to share first February sketches with 'Cirque' kits. I chose to work with a scrapbook sketch based on April's layout. I love simple sketches becasue than you can mess with an example (which in other hand is a perfection). But the idea is to use the sketch and create something in your own style. I was inspired by two things this time: with my favourite 'Europe map' stamp and die and by the huge letters which I used to create white on white title (the alphabet is coming from the January 'Ivy Tower' add-on). I used the pictures from my last trip to Spain where I was teaching mixed media classes. The layout is about my dreamy scrapbook work, about amazing people I meet in various countries, etc... I just love my job, it incorporates all the things I adore in my life: art, people, travelling, different languages and customs. This layout remind me that my beloved Poland is not that far away from the rest of the beautiful places in Europe :)

Supplies: Kits - Cirque Scrapbook Kit, Ivy Tower, Far Far Away Scrapbook Kit; Die Set - Europe Stamp & Die Set; rub-ons - Ashley Goldberg Gold Splattered Rub-ons
